caminho clandestino

[kə-ˈmi-ɲu klɐ̃-ˈdɛʃ-ti-nu]
nounmasculinepl: caminhos clandestinos
underground route; clandestine path; secret passage
1. A hidden or secret route used to avoid detection, often for illegal purposes or during times of oppression
During the war, refugees used clandestine paths to escape to safety.
Durante a guerra, refugiados usavam caminhos clandestinos para escapar para a segurança.
2. A route taken covertly, especially relating to smuggling, human trafficking, or political dissent
The migrants followed a clandestine route to avoid border patrols.
Os migrantes seguiram um caminho clandestino para evitar as patrulhas fronteiriças.
3. An underground network or system of escape routes, particularly historically associated with resistance movements
The Underground Railroad was a clandestine network of routes and safe houses.
A Ferrovia Clandestina era uma rede de caminhos clandestinos e casas seguras.
